For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public high schools serving 866 students in Paducah Independent School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public high schools in Kentucky.
Public High Schools in Paducah Independent School District have an average math proficiency score of 23% (versus the Kentucky public high school average of 33%), and reading proficiency score of 39% (versus the 44% statewide average).
Public High School in Paducah Independent School District have a Graduation Rate of 86%, which is less than the Kentucky average of 92%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Paducah Tilghman High School, with 92%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Kentucky or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 62%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Kentucky public high school average of 28% (majority Black and Hispanic).

The revenue/student of $16,249 is higher than the state median of $14,250. The school district revenue/student has grown by 9%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$16,515 is higher than the state median of $13,989.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
